    OEM Floormats?

    Which oem floormats fit in our cars?


    Right now I just know the 90-93 accord floormats fit in our cars. I'm wondering what else is there because 90-93 doesn't really exist anymore. I'm looking at getting some new black floormats.

    I really like my 6th gen Accord floormats! They don't fit "exact", but pretty darn close. Close enough that you don't really even notice unless you're looking for it.

    Funny thing is, I got these at the junkyard out of a red 88-89 DX coupe with black interior. $3.25 per mat and near mint condition.... can't argue with that!

    when i went to the dealer for mats, they said that had been discontinued and had none sitting in a warehouse, but to ask other dealerships that might possibly have a set in stock due to an order that wasn't picked up back in the early 90's or what-not...

    since the 4gee mats fit, the dealership might still have those since they are a generation newer...
